		<title>ZFS Mirrored Root Pool Disk Replacement</title>
		<link>https://www.leppa.de/wp2/zfs-mirrored-root-pool-disk-replacement/</link>
		
		<dc:creator><![CDATA[Jens Appel]]></dc:creator>
		<pubDate>Tue, 29 Mar 2011 14:35:46 +0000</pubDate>
				<category><![CDATA[Solaris]]></category>
		<category><![CDATA[rootmirror]]></category>
		<category><![CDATA[solaris]]></category>
		<category><![CDATA[ZFS]]></category>
		<guid isPermaLink="false">http://www.psj-world.de/wp2/?p=475</guid>

					<description><![CDATA[<p>If a disk in a mirrored root pool fails, you can either replace the disk or attach a replacement disk and then detach the failed disk. The basic steps are like this: Identify the disk to be replaced by using the zpool status command. You can do a live disk replacement if the system supports [&#8230;]</p>

		<title>Xvnc unter Solaris</title>
		<link>https://www.leppa.de/wp2/xvnc-unter-solaris/</link>
		
		<dc:creator><![CDATA[Jens Appel]]></dc:creator>
		<pubDate>Wed, 12 Aug 2009 16:55:00 +0000</pubDate>
				<category><![CDATA[Computer]]></category>
		<category><![CDATA[solaris]]></category>
		<category><![CDATA[xvnc]]></category>
		<guid isPermaLink="false">http://www.home.leppa.de/wp/?p=178</guid>

					<description><![CDATA[<p>Xvnc unter Solaris als Dienst für die Anmeldung: &#8218;vnc&#8216; Eintrag in /etc/services hinzufügen # echo 'vnc  5900/tcp' &#62;&#62;/etc/services inetd Konfiguration anlegen # echo 'vnc stream tcp nowait nobody /usr/local/bin/Xvnc Xvnc \ -inetd -query localhost -once securitytypes=none' &#62; vnc.inetd.conf inetd Konfiguration importieren # inetconv -i vnc.inetd.conf nachträglich Änderungen an der Konfiguration durchführen # inetadm -m network/vnc/tcp [&#8230;]</p>
